Water cut in Homagama and Pelanwatta for 12 hours due to dry weather

April 9, 2026 at 2:09 PM

The National Water Supply and Drainage Board has announced a 12‑hour water cut in the Homagama and Pelanwatta areas due to prevailing dry weather conditions.

According to the Board, water supply to Homagama will be suspended from 8.00 p.m. today (09) until 8.00 a.m. tomorrow (10). 

The affected areas include Homagama town, Wekanda Road, Pinketha Road, Walawwa Road, Gamunu Mawatha, Athurugiriya Road, Galavilawatta, Niyandagala, Mahakatuwana, Magammana, Deniya, and Diyagama University.

In addition, water supply to Pelanwatta, Siddamulla, Aruwala, Nivanthidiya, Bokundara Road, Ratmaldeniya, Maharagama–Piliyandala Road, Moraketiya Road, Hiripitiya, Gorakapitiya Road, Niyandagala Road – Dolekade Junction, Kudamaduwa up to the 225 bus route, and Pubudu Mawatha up to the 225 bus route will be suspended tomorrow (10) from 8.00 a.m. to 8.00 p.m.

The Board urged residents in the affected areas to take necessary measures to manage their water usage during the suspension period. (Newswire)
